Historical note

In 2007, Mitsubishi Heavy Industries began developing a combat vehicle to enhance the mobility of armored units. The main requirements were to avoid the limitations of tracked vehicles, the ability to respond quickly to invasion threats, and the ability to be transported by sea and air to remote regions. As early as 2008, four prototypes were ordered, and development continued until 2013.

After intensive testing, ended in 2016, the vehicle was officially adopted by the Japan Self-Defense Forces under the designation Type 16 MCV (maneuver combat vehicle). The Type 16 MCV remains in service with the JSDF to this day.

Type 16 (FPS)

The new platoon of Japanese armored vehicles of Rank IX is led by a special version of the Type 16 (FPS) combat vehicle, a representative of the first production series. Three priorities guided the engineers in its design: mobility, firepower and lightness.

The wheeled vehicle turned out to be very fast. In fact, the new Type 16 (FPS) will be one of the fastest armored vehicles in the game! This speed along with high power density makes it a great choice for quick point taking, flanking and unexpected ambushes.

The Type 16 (FPS) is armed with a 105mm cannon with good rate of fire and stabilizer. The main shell for the vehicle will be an effective APFSDS DM23. Other types of ammunition are APFSDS M735, HEATFS, HESH – at the commander's discretion. Smoke shells are great for concealment and quick relocation.

The Type 16 (FPS) armor is light. The vehicle can confidently withstand only machine gun fire. That's why speed and good reactions are the main resources of the Type 16 (FPS) commander. Use the Type 16's features and be the first to get into a good position or capture points while the enemy team is just getting out of spawn.

ICV (P)

Another wheeled vehicle of the new Japanese platoon will be the ICV(P). It is very similar to the platoon leader – the same high speed, light armor. But the weaponry is noticeably different: high-speed 30 mm Bushmaster 2 Mk.44 cannon with APFSDS and APDS belts is perfect for close combat – can penetrate almost any enemy!

Type 74 (F)

This is one of the latest modifications of the Type 74 main battle tank. The vehicle is quite versatile – good mobility, excellent 105 mm L7 cannon and superb APFSDS make the tank especially successful for a sniper role and long range firefights.

Type 87

The Type 87 tracked SPAAG with 35mm cannons makes a great support vehicle or self-contained gunner: its mobility and high rate of fire allows the commander a wide range of tactics.
